# Author Model Advisor Check

## When to Use

- User provides any modeling constraint (e.g., "blocks shall...", "signals must match...")
- User asks to create a guideline for modeling
- User asks to author, implement, or write a Model Advisor check
- User asks to test, qualify, or validate a custom check
- User mentions "enforce", "standard", "compliance rule", or "modeling rule"

## When NOT to Use

- Post-hoc compliance checking of existing models — use `checking-model-compliance`
- General model building without enforcement context — use `building-simulink-models`
- Running existing checks or viewing results — use Model Advisor directly

## STEP 3: Generate Test Spec + Qualify with Tests

**CRITICAL — TDD Independence:** Derive test cases ONLY from the guideline and the user's original constraint. NEVER read the check spec or implementation. See `references/procedures/test-check.md` § TDD Independence Guardrail.

**Execute Test Spec:** Generate test spec document following `references/templates/test-spec.md`, feeding in the guideline and the user's original constraint. Save to `<output_dir>/<id>-test-spec.md`.

**Present the test spec** to the user using the summary format defined in `references/templates/test-spec.md` — show key fields (guideline ID, check ID, check type, auto-fix) and the test cases table. End with the saved path.

**Test Plan Review — Pause and ask the user:**

Ask the user to review the test spec before implementation:

Options:
1. "Looks good, proceed with test generation (Recommended)"
2. "I have changes to the test plan"

If user selects option 2, wait for their feedback, update the test spec accordingly, then proceed. Otherwise proceed immediately.

**Execute Tests:** Follow `references/procedures/test-check.md` using the (potentially updated) test spec as input. Run tests and present results (N passed, N failed).

**CRITICAL — Test Execution Retry Limit:**
If tests fail after the initial run:
- Analyze the failure root cause (model issue vs. check logic vs. test assertion)
- Apply a targeted fix
- Re-run tests
- **Maximum 3 retry attempts.** If tests still fail after 3 retries, STOP and report the status honestly:
  ```
  Tests: X passed, Y failed (after 3 fix attempts)
  Remaining failures: <list with brief description>
  Recommended next steps: <what the user should investigate>
  ```
- Do NOT enter an unbounded fix loop

**After tests complete (or retry limit reached), present the Final Report.** Workflow ends.

## Halt & Cleanup

If the user says "stop", "no", "halt", or "don't continue" at ANY point during optimistic execution:

1. **Stop immediately** — do not begin the next step
2. **Delete artifacts from the step currently in progress** (not yet completed):
   - If halted during STEP 2: delete check spec, check definition `.m`, and `sl_customization.m` entries that were being generated
   - If halted during STEP 3: delete test spec, test class `.m`, and test model `.slx` files that were being generated
3. **Keep all completed step artifacts** — guideline stays if Step 1 finished, check stays if Step 2 finished
4. **Present Final Report** showing what was kept and what was removed
